CCEA clears KKR's proposals to acquire stakes in 2 pharma companies

Cabinet Committee on Economic Affairs, CCEA today cleared private equity major KKR's proposals to acquire stakes in two pharmaceutical companies. Highly placed sources said, the two deals are estimated to be worth 1,434 crore rupees. The first proposal relates to acquisition of about 38 per cent stake by KKR Floorline Investments PTE in Hyderabad-based Gland Pharma.In the other proposal cleared by the CCEA, KKR would acquire 24.9 per cent stake in Gland Celsus Bio Chemicals Pvt Ltd. In January this year, Competition Commission of India had approved the deals.
